Intern : Programme Support and Communications Intern – Environmental Governance and Peacebuilding in Somalia
Description
• Currently enrolled in or recently graduated from a graduate program + one year of experience in international development, environmental governance and peacebuilding, conflict studies, environmental studies, climate change, public policy, project management, or related field. Applicants to the UN Internship Programme are not required to have professional work. experience. However, a field of study that is closely related to the type of internship that you are applying for is required. Applicants must be a student in the final year of the first university degree (bachelor or equivalent), Master’s or Ph.D. Programme or equivalent, or have completed a Bachelor’s, Master’s or PH.D. Programme. Do you meet any of the above criteria? If yes, please indicate which one and attach proof to the application. Please note that you will have to provide an official certificate at a later stage.
